Heavy Metals Pollution and Pb Isotopic Signatures in Surface Sediments Collected from Bohai Bay, North China

Table 1

Heavy metal concentrations in surface sediments of Bohai Bay and other Bays in China (mg/kg).

StationCrNiCuZnCdPbReferences

Minimum51.3221.8816.8445.310.1120.69This study
Maximum94.3347.0434.9984.190.1828.33
Mean79.7336.5628.7072.830.1525.63
Variable coefficient (%)11.3913.8412.7112.0410.297.25
Intertidal Bohai Bay, China68.628.024.073.00.1225.6[5]
Southern Bohai Bay, China33.530.522.771.70.1421.7[9]
Western Bohai Bay, China53.131.427.983.60.1320.5[8]
Upper continental crust352025710.09816.6[12]
Yangtze Estuary, China78.931.830.794.30.2627.3[18]
Pearl River Estuary, China89.041.746.2150n.d.59.3[19]
Marine sediment quality I80n.d.351500.560[20]
Marine sediment quality II150n.d.1003501.5130[20]
Target*252020750.435[13]
Trigger*5035551501.065[13]
Action*8040652001.575[13]

Target indicates the desired quality for fairly clean sediment that is close to background levels.
Trigger indicates that the sediment is moderately contaminated.
Action indicates heavily polluted sediments.
